refinishing deployable steps

I have noticed that my deployable steps have started to peel their, presumably powder coating in places. Shame as the rest of the car is mint. Has anyone refinished these? They look to me that they are aluminium so not sure they will stand up to being sandblasted and then repainted or powder coated.
